Recently finished:
Since my last WWW Wednesday I’ve read 3 books of varying degrees of likeability. The first, The Confession by Jessie Burton was a 4 star read that I bought purely for the gorgeous cover but which proved to be just as beautiful on the inside. I love when that happens. Full review here.
The second, Quiet by Susan Cain ended up being disappointing and was actually shelved in my ‘better in the reviews’ list on Goodreads. Unfortunately, it just didn’t live up to the hype. I only gave it 3 stars – those were for the few chapters that, while not offering any new information were at least interesting.
Thirdly, The Giver of Stars by Jojo Moyes was a definite 5 star read. I loved this book so much…as I was listening it reminded me of Where the Crawdads Sing by Delia Owens in writing style; taking me to an entirely different place and time. Perfect as an audiobook; the narration was brilliant; the story captivating, emotional and uplifting.
